Voice
Migration from traditional voice
telephony to VoIP is made easy by tight
integration of VoIP services with QoS and
firewall. OmniAccess USG routers provide
the highest throughput and lowest
latency for voice traffic. OmniAccess 5510
USG supports a hosted SIP Application
Layer Gateway (ALG) solution, which
enables the VoIP phones behind the
firewall to exchange voice and call control
messages with Session Border Controller
residing in Service Provider network.
Security
OmniAccess 5510 USG provides a robust
set of security features. The security-
first architecture protects the enterprise
networks from most sophisticated threats
and keeps abreast of new threat
mitigation software with support for
signature-based Intrusion Detection
System (IDS) /Intrusion Prevention System
(IPS). Protection against DoS attacks
provides extra security against rogue
users and campus hackers. A gamut of
IPSec VPN options are supported,
including site-to-site VPN for branches
and headquarter secure connectivity,
IPSec client for telecommuter and
Dynamic Multipoint VPN (DMVPN) to
ease the provisioning of any-to-any IPSec
tunnel mesh and the addition of new
sites. Dynamic mesh of the IPSec
tunnel also eases the voice deployment
for enterprises and SMBs because of
removing the voice ALG complications.
Instant Connectivity for Remote /
Nomadic Sites
OmniAccess 5510 USG can provide
immediate and low cost connectivity
through its 3G interface for remote
locations or for the branches requiring
an immediate connectivity. For
construction sites or retail stores which
require a fast deployment, a 3G interface
is the optimal solution. With support
for secure tunnels over a 3G interface,
OA 5510 USG ensures that newer
branch offices can be integrated in the
network within a short time span.
Carrier Managed Services
OmniAccess 5510 USG enables Service
Providers to offer differentiated
Managed VPN services and Managed
Security services to their enterprise
customers. As part of Managed VPN,
Service Providers can offer both
premium IP-VPNs and Layer 2 Carrier
Ethernet VPNs, which allows them to
differentiate their service offering from
a low margin bandwidth-only service.
OmniAccess 5510 USG integrates a
unified management layer that allows it
to be managed from a TR069-based
Alcatel-Lucent 5580 HNM or SNMP-
based 5620 SAM
1
from Alcatel-Lucent.
With support for true Zero touch
deployment through custom default
configuration, providers can save on
costly truck rolls to customer premises.

Carrier Managed IP Services
A comprehensive set of routing,
multi-VRF CE functionality, QoS
features, integrated management,
and Ethernet-OAM features in the
OmniAccess 5510 USG enables the
service providers to offer business class
Layer 3 VPN or Managed IP Access
services to their customers. The OAM
feature set is consistent with the
Alcatel-Lucent Service Router feature
set, thus enabling end-to-end services
troubleshooting and management by
the provider, and allowing them to
honor SLAs.
Carrier Managed Ethernet
Services
OmniAccess 5510 USG router enables
service providers to extend VPLS
enabled Carrier Ethernet VPNs to their
customers. Bridging Control Protocol
(BCP), Ethernet over Frame-relay,
Ethernet over cHDLC, Ethernet
Bridging over ADSL enables Ethernet
bridging on all WAN links including
Ethernet, TDM, Serial and ADSL.
This helps the Providers to offer
VPLS/Ethernet services even over
non-Ethernet WAN links to the
Enterprise customers. By delivering
Ethernet access over a range of access
technology, Service Providers can
leverage their investment on these
access technologies, and also leverage
them to go next-generation access
connectivity.
